Questions About Chicken Legs? Get Them Answered
Yes, you can substitute chicken thighs for legs. Just ensure they reach the same internal temperature of 165F and adjust cooking time slightly based on their size.
While fresh minced garlic provides more intense flavor, garlic powder works perfectly fine in this recipe and offers convenient seasoning.
The basic recipe is naturally gluten-free. Just double-check that your Parmesan cheese and seasonings do not contain any gluten-containing additives.
Use a meat thermometer to check that the internal temperature reaches 165F. The chicken skin should also look crispy and golden brown when properly cooked.

Garlic Parmesan Chicken Legs Recipe
- Total Time: 50 minutes
- Yield: 4 1x
Description
Succulent garlic parmesan chicken legs deliver a flavor explosion that elevates weeknight dinners from ordinary to extraordinary. Crispy, golden-brown skin coated with savory herbs and nutty parmesan promises a mouthwatering experience you won’t soon forget.
Ingredients
Protein:
- 8 chicken drumsticks (about 907 grams)
Seasonings and Spices:
- 1 teaspoon salt
- ½ teaspoon black pepper
- 1 teaspoon garlic powder
- 1 teaspoon onion powder
- ½ teaspoon paprika
Additional Ingredients:
- 2 tablespoons olive oil
- ¼ cup unsalted butter, melted
- 4 garlic cloves, minced
- ½ cup grated Parmesan cheese
- 2 tablespoons chopped fresh parsley (optional)
Instructions
- Meticulously cleanse chicken legs by patting them completely dry using absorbent paper towels, ensuring surface moisture is eliminated.
- Transfer chicken to a spacious mixing vessel and generously coat with olive oil, seasoning comprehensively with salt, pepper, garlic powder, onion powder, and paprika, massaging spices thoroughly into the meat.
- Select cooking method: For oven preparation, position wire rack atop baking sheet and arrange seasoned drumsticks carefully, maintaining slight separation between pieces.
- Roast in preheated 400F oven, rotating drumsticks midway through cooking process to guarantee uniform browning and crispy exterior.
- Monitor internal temperature, ensuring chicken reaches critical 165F safety threshold, typically requiring 35-40 minutes total cooking duration.
- Alternatively, air fryer enthusiasts can prepare drumsticks at 380F, rotating midcycle and achieving perfect doneness within 25-28 minutes.
- During chicken’s cooking interval, craft luxurious garlic parmesan coating by combining melted butter with finely minced garlic and freshly grated parmesan cheese.
- Once chicken achieves optimal crispness and temperature, immediately transfer hot drumsticks into prepared butter mixture, gently tumbling to achieve complete, even coverage.
- Finish presentation by generously sprinkling additional parmesan and freshly chopped parsley, creating vibrant visual and flavor enhancement.
- Serve immediately while maintaining optimal temperature and crispy texture.
Notes
- Ensure chicken legs are thoroughly patted dry to achieve ultra-crispy skin that locks in maximum flavor and creates a delightful crunch.
- Experiment with different cheese variations like aged Pecorino or sharp Asiago for unique flavor profiles that can elevate the classic Parmesan coating.
- Check internal temperature with a meat thermometer to guarantee chicken is perfectly cooked without drying out, aiming for the safe 165F mark that ensures juicy meat every time.
- Adjust cooking time slightly for larger or smaller chicken legs, remembering smaller pieces cook faster and can easily become overcooked and tough.
